This litigation concerns the Estate of Basile Sipidias.
The primary issue on this motion was whether the parties had reached a binding settlement agreement at a judicial mediation on January 17, 2023.
Evangeline Sipidias (a respondent and estate trustee) brought the motion to enforce the settlement, supported by Theodore Sipidias (the applicant).
Constantin Sipidias (another respondent and estate trustee) opposed, arguing no settlement was reached or that it was vitiated by misrepresentation regarding a joint bank account.
The court found that a settlement of essential terms was reached, as evidenced by the presiding judge's endorsements.
The alleged innocent misrepresentation regarding the joint bank account was deemed not material enough to rescind the settlement, given the small amount at stake relative to the total estate value and the long history of litigation.
The court also approved the settlement on behalf of George Sipidias, a beneficiary under legal disability, finding it to be in his best interest.
